Types of Sanders Suitable for Plywood Floors
Plywood floors require specific types of sanders to achieve the desired smoothness and finish. There are several types of sanders available, including belt sanders, orbital sanders, and drum sanders. Belt sanders are ideal for large, open areas and are capable of removing old finishes and imperfections quickly. Orbital sanders, on the other hand, are better suited for smaller areas and are perfect for fine-tuning and polishing the floor. Drum sanders are designed for heavy-duty use and are often used for commercial or industrial applications.
When choosing a sander for a plywood floor, it’s essential to consider the type of finish desired. For a high-gloss finish, an orbital sander may be the best choice, while a belt sander may be more suitable for a matte or satin finish. Additionally, the size and shape of the sander can impact its effectiveness. A larger sander may be more efficient for big areas, but a smaller sander may be more maneuverable and easier to use in tight spaces.
The power source of the sander is also an important consideration. Electric sanders are convenient and easy to use, but they may not be suitable for large areas or heavy-duty use. Gas-powered sanders, on the other hand, are more powerful and can handle bigger jobs, but they can be noisy and produce emissions. Cordless sanders offer more flexibility and convenience, but their battery life may be limited.
In addition to the type of sander, the grit of the sandpaper is also crucial. A lower grit sandpaper is used for removing old finishes and imperfections, while a higher grit sandpaper is used for fine-tuning and polishing. Using the right grit sandpaper can make a significant difference in the final finish of the plywood floor.

Precautions and Safety Measures When Sanding Plywood Floors
Sanding plywood floors can be a safe and effective way to achieve a smooth finish, but it requires some precautions and safety measures. One of the most important safety measures is to wear protective gear, including a dust mask, safety glasses, and ear protection. Sanding can create a lot of dust and noise, which can be harmful to the lungs and ears.
Another important precaution is to ensure good ventilation in the work area. Sanding can create a lot of dust, which can be hazardous to breathe. Opening windows and doors can help to improve ventilation and reduce the risk of inhaling dust. Additionally, using a dust collector or vacuum can help to minimize the amount of dust in the air.
It’s also essential to follow the manufacturer’s instructions when using a sander. This includes reading the manual, following the recommended speed and pressure settings, and using the correct type of sandpaper. Using a sander incorrectly can result in damage to the floor, injury to the user, or both.
In addition to these precautions, it’s also important to be mindful of the surrounding area. Sanding can create a lot of dust and debris, which can damage furniture, carpets, and other surfaces. Covering these surfaces with drop cloths or plastic sheets can help to protect them from damage. Additionally, sanding can be a messy process, so it’s essential to have a clean-up plan in place to minimize the mess and make the process more efficient.

Power and Speed
The power and speed of a sander are crucial factors to consider, as they determine how efficiently and effectively the tool can handle the sanding task. A more powerful sander with higher speed settings can tackle tougher jobs and larger areas, but it may also be heavier and more difficult to maneuver. On the other hand, a less powerful sander with lower speed settings may be more suitable for smaller areas and finer details, but it may take longer to complete the task. It’s essential to consider the size and complexity of your plywood floor project when evaluating the power and speed of a sander.
When evaluating the power and speed of a sander, look for the motor’s wattage or amp rating, as well as the number of orbits or strokes per minute. A higher wattage or amp rating generally indicates a more powerful motor, while a higher number of orbits or strokes per minute indicates faster sanding action. Some sanders also come with variable speed controls, which allow you to adjust the speed to suit the specific task at hand. This feature can be particularly useful when working with different types of wood or when switching between coarse and fine grit sandpaper.
Dust Collection
Dust collection is another critical factor to consider when choosing a sander, as it can significantly impact the cleanliness and safety of your work environment. A sander with a built-in dust collection system or a compatible dust collection attachment can help to minimize dust and debris, reducing the risk of inhalation and making cleanup easier. Look for sanders with a dust collection port or a detachable dust bag, and consider the size and capacity of the dust collection system to ensure it can handle the amount of dust generated by your project.
When evaluating the dust collection capabilities of a sander, consider the type of dust collection system and its effectiveness. Some sanders come with a simple dust bag or canister, while others feature more advanced systems with HEPA filters or cyclonic dust collection. These advanced systems can be more effective at capturing fine dust particles and reducing the amount of dust that escapes into the air. Additionally, consider the ease of emptying and cleaning the dust collection system, as well as the availability of replacement dust bags or filters.

How do I choose the right grit sandpaper for my plywood floor?
Choosing the right grit sandpaper for a plywood floor depends on the level of finish desired and the current condition of the floor. For rough, unfinished plywood, a coarse grit sandpaper (about 80-100) is usually best, as it can quickly remove old finishes, splinters, and other imperfections. For smoother, finished plywood, a finer grit sandpaper (120-150) may be more suitable, as it can help to create a high-gloss finish without scratching the surface.
It’s also important to progress through the grits in a logical order, starting with a coarse grit and moving to finer grits as the sanding process continues. This will help to prevent scratches and other imperfections, and ensure a smooth, even finish. Additionally, it’s a good idea to use a sandpaper with a high-quality abrasive, such as aluminum oxide or silicon carbide, as these will provide better cutting power and longer lifespan. It’s also a good idea to read the manufacturer’s recommendations for the specific sandpaper being used.

How do I avoid scratches when sanding a plywood floor?
To avoid scratches when sanding a plywood floor, it’s a good idea to start with a coarse grit sandpaper and progress to finer grits as the sanding process continues. This will help to prevent deep scratches and other imperfections, and ensure a smooth, even finish. Additionally, it’s a good idea to use a sander with a variable speed control, as this will allow for more precise control over the sanding process.
It’s also important to work slowly and carefully, and to avoid applying too much pressure to the sander. This can cause the sandpaper to dig into the surface, leading to scratches and other imperfections. Additionally, it’s a good idea to keep the sander moving at all times, as this will help to prevent the sandpaper from digging into the surface and causing scratches. It’s also a good idea to use a sandpaper with a high-quality abrasive, such as aluminum oxide or silicon carbide, as these will provide better cutting power and longer lifespan.
